Гость
Целевая тема:
Создать новую тему:
Автор:
Форумы / C++ [игнор отключен] [закрыт для гостей] / Компиляция С кода в Borand C++ / 4 сообщений из 4, страница 1 из 1
23.03.2007, 22:55
    #34412997
тот самый
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Компиляция С кода в Borand C++
Привет всем!

Плиз хелп

Пришлось столкнуться с компилятцией исходников С в Borlan C++. При файла SQUARES.c компиляции выдает:

[Linker Error] Unresolved external '_cvGetRows' referenced from C:\10\SQUARES.OBJ
[Linker Error] Unresolved external '_cvGetCols' referenced from C:\10\SQUARES.OBJ
[Linker Error] Unresolved external '_cvAddS' referenced from C:\10\SQUARES.OBJ
[Linker Error] Unresolved external '_cvSeqSlice' referenced from C:\10\SQUARES.OBJ
[Linker Error] Unresolved external '_cvSetAdd' referenced from C:\10\SQUARES.OBJ
..........

В чем проблемма. и как правильно настроить опции Borlsand C++, чтобы откомпелировать проект на С


Сенкс
...
Рейтинг: 0 / 0
21.05.2007, 15:02
    #34539809
HAS
HAS
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Компиляция С кода в Borand C++
могу предположить следующее:
1. не хватает какой-то либы
2. не хватает исходника с этими функциями
...
Рейтинг: 0 / 0
22.05.2007, 08:31
    #34541223
muk07
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Компиляция С кода в Borand C++
может это из-за того, что с++ приделывает именам ф-й префиксы-суффиксы, соответствующие сигнатуре. Вы пробовали объявлять функции как си (не с++)?
например:
Код: plaintext
extern "C" __export WINAPI тип имя ф-ии (параметры);
...
Рейтинг: 0 / 0
22.05.2007, 19:47
    #34543654
White Owl
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Компиляция С кода в Borand C++
muk07может это из-за того, что с++ приделывает именам ф-й префиксы-суффиксы, соответствующие сигнатуре. Вы пробовали объявлять функции как си (не с++)?
например:
Код: plaintext
extern "C" __export WINAPI тип имя ф-ии (параметры);
Неверный совет. Игры с extern "C" имеют смысл только в том случае если ты из С++ пытаешься вызвать С функцию. А тот самый изначально пишет на С.
...
Рейтинг: 0 / 0
Форумы / C++ [игнор отключен] [закрыт для гостей] / Компиляция С кода в Borand C++ / 4 сообщений из 4, страница 1 из 1
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]